summaryrefslogtreecommitdiffhomepage
path: root/gui
diff options
context:
space:
mode:
authorMarkus Pettersson <markus.pettersson@mullvad.net>2024-10-28 18:57:50 +0100
committerMarkus Pettersson <markus.pettersson@mullvad.net>2024-10-29 12:56:04 +0100
commitea86ce352e746ed469a5cac8f54f04636a15c615 (patch)
tree5b09aa86a5f1bc121cc481e5a48f907abc0da09f /gui
parent5ece19a061738fa93169b82c82be11ac07bed93a (diff)
downloadmullvadvpn-ea86ce352e746ed469a5cac8f54f04636a15c615.tar.xz
mullvadvpn-ea86ce352e746ed469a5cac8f54f04636a15c615.zip
Fix `api-access-methods.spec` - counting of access methods was off
Diffstat (limited to 'gui')
-rw-r--r--gui/test/e2e/installed/state-dependent/api-access-methods.spec.ts9
1 files changed, 6 insertions, 3 deletions
diff --git a/gui/test/e2e/installed/state-dependent/api-access-methods.spec.ts b/gui/test/e2e/installed/state-dependent/api-access-methods.spec.ts
index 662ac4bf2a..a447b5975e 100644
--- a/gui/test/e2e/installed/state-dependent/api-access-methods.spec.ts
+++ b/gui/test/e2e/installed/state-dependent/api-access-methods.spec.ts
@@ -84,7 +84,8 @@ test('App should add invalid access method', async () => {
).toEqual(RoutePath.apiAccessMethods);
const accessMethods = page.getByTestId('access-method');
- await expect(accessMethods).toHaveCount(3);
+ // Direct, Bridges, Encrypted DNS Proxy & the non-functioning access method.
+ await expect(accessMethods).toHaveCount(4);
await expect(accessMethods.last()).toHaveText(NON_FUNCTIONING_METHOD_NAME);
});
@@ -137,7 +138,8 @@ test('App should edit access method', async () => {
);
const accessMethods = page.getByTestId('access-method');
- await expect(accessMethods).toHaveCount(3);
+ // Direct, Bridges, Encrypted DNS Proxy & the custom access method.
+ await expect(accessMethods).toHaveCount(4);
await expect(accessMethods.last()).toHaveText(FUNCTIONING_METHOD_NAME);
});
@@ -172,5 +174,6 @@ test('App should delete method', async () => {
await expect(page.getByText(`Delete ${FUNCTIONING_METHOD_NAME}?`)).toBeVisible();
await page.locator('button:has-text("Delete")').click();
- await expect(accessMethods).toHaveCount(2);
+ // Direct, Bridges, Encrypted DNS Proxy.
+ await expect(accessMethods).toHaveCount(3);
});